Unlocking the World: The Benefits of Learning New Languages for Kids

Unlocking the World: The Benefits of Learning New Languages for Kids

26.04.2024

In today's interconnected world, the ability to communicate across languages is becoming increasingly valuable. For children, learning a new language isn't just about mastering vocabulary and grammar; it's a gateway to broadening their horizons, enhancing cognitive abilities, and fostering cultural understanding. Let's delve into the myriad benefits of why children should embark on the exciting journey of learning new languages.

Cognitive Development

One of the most significant advantages of learning a new language during childhood is its positive impact on cognitive development. Research has shown that bilingual or multilingual children often exhibit enhanced problem-solving skills, better memory retention, and improved multitasking abilities compared to monolingual peers. The process of learning and switching between languages stimulates various regions of the brain, promoting neural growth and flexibility.

Academic Success

The cognitive benefits of multilingualism often translate into academic success across various subjects. Studies have indicated that bilingual children tend to perform better on standardized tests, particularly in areas such as math, reading, and vocabulary. Additionally, learning a new language can instill a greater appreciation for language arts and literature, as children gain insights into different linguistic structures and storytelling traditions.

Cultural Understanding and Empathy

Language is not just a means of communication; it's also deeply intertwined with culture. By learning a new language, children gain a deeper understanding of diverse cultures, traditions, and perspectives. This exposure fosters empathy and tolerance, as children learn to appreciate the richness of human diversity. Moreover, it lays the foundation for building global connections and forming friendships with peers from different linguistic and cultural backgrounds.

Expanded Opportunities

In today's globalized economy, proficiency in multiple languages is a valuable asset that opens doors to a wide range of opportunities. Multilingual individuals have a competitive edge in the job market, as many employers seek candidates with language skills to engage with international clients and navigate cross-cultural contexts. By starting their language-learning journey early, children can acquire fluency and confidence that will serve them well in future academic and professional endeavors.

Enhanced Communication Skills

Learning a new language is a dynamic process that goes beyond mere memorization of words and phrases. It involves honing listening, speaking, reading, and writing skills, which are essential components of effective communication. By practicing these skills in different languages, children become more adept at expressing themselves clearly and articulately, whether in their native tongue or a foreign language. This proficiency in communication can boost self-confidence and interpersonal relationships.

Personal Growth and Self-Discovery

Embarking on the journey of learning a new language is not just about acquiring linguistic competence; it's also a journey of personal growth and self-discovery. Children develop resilience, patience, and perseverance as they navigate the challenges of language acquisition. They learn to embrace mistakes as opportunities for learning and develop a growth mindset that extends beyond language learning to other areas of life. Moreover, discovering new languages and cultures sparks curiosity and a sense of wonder, enriching children's lives in profound ways.

 

In a rapidly changing world characterized by diversity and interconnectedness, learning new languages has become more than just a valuable skill—it's an essential tool for thriving in the 21st century.
